Is there a way to make the meta.function-call
text mate rule to take precedence over entity.name.function
?
In VS Code Crystal (Ruby-like language) setting both method definition and method call marked with the entity.name.function
token.
I would like to have method definition as bold but method calls as not bold. But it doesn't work as I can't override entity.name.function
with meta.function-call
My setting.json
:
{
"editor.tokenColorCustomizations": {
"textMateRules": [
{
"scope": [
"entity.name.function"
],
"settings": { "foreground": "#3730A3", "fontStyle": "bold" }
},
{
"scope": [
"meta.function-call"
],
"settings": { "foreground": "#111827", "fontStyle": "" }
}
]
}
}
Specify multiple scopes delimited by whitespace:
{
"name": "function definition",
"scope": [
"entity.name.function"
],
"settings": {
"foreground": "#ff0000"
}
},
{
"name": "function call",
"scope": [
"meta.function-call entity.name.function"
],
"settings": {
"foreground": "#0000ff"
}
},
